Iordered mine from Spoiler Depot in Florida, perfect knock off oem m style spoiler and color match was bang on ( a/p). Cost was around 250 usd . Application was not bad,but if you are not handy get a body shop or the Dealer to install. It really is the finishing touch for the MSport .

BTW I am adding a roof spoiler as well

No, no. I was just playing around with ECF. He isn't biting. I used to have the M rear lip spoiler. It would set off your 08 550i just right. By all means do get the lip spoiler.

As you can see from my sig below I took off the lip spoiler b/c the double-sided tape used to secure it was not tight. I never got around to putting it back on and decided to sell it to torquey5.
